Cabinet Secretary nominee for National Treasury and Planning Njuguna Ndung’u has revealed he has a net worth of Sh950 million.

Ndung’u made the revelation on Tuesday when he appeared before the National Assembly Committee on appointments for vetting.

“I’m currently earning in dollars but its translated into Sh950 million,” he said

He also stated that he was currently salaried under the Africa Economic Research Consortium, but said his anticipated earning would be gratuity once his contract comes to an end.

Ndung’u previously served as CBK governor for a two four-year term between 2007 and 2015. He was succeeded by Dr. Patrick Njoroge.

He has been accredited for facilitating the entry of mobile-money in Kenya’s financial sector despite opposition from commercial banks a move that has enhanced financial access in the country.
